The sought-after small town of Syston is situated to the north of the City of Leicester, on the edge of the renowned Charnwood Forest with its many scenic country walks and golf courses, and is well known for its popularity in terms of convenience for ease of access to the afore-mentioned centre of employment, as well as the market towns of Loughborough, Melton Mowbray, Oakham and Uppingham, the East Midlands International Airport at Castle Donington and the A46M1M69 major road network for travel north, south and west.
Syston also offers a fine range of local amenities including shopping for all day-to-day needs, schooling for all ages, a wide variety of recreational amenities and regular public transport services by both road and rail.
